My dog's eye was poked, now the third eyelid is out. What's wrong?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

I’m not sure what is wrong with my dogs eye. My other dog poked it yesterday morning and it now looks like this. He isn’t in pain when I touch it, but it does not look right to me.

The third eyelid is out. The third eyelid is a normal part of the anatomy of a dog's eye, but it should not be out when the eye is open. That tells me something is wrong with his eye. Any eye problem needs to be checked out by a vet promptly, as leaving it untreated can lead to vision loss. Please take him into a vet now.
